CII academy roadshow
The CII is gearing up to tour the country with industry leaders to launch the first broker academy. With supporters including AXA, Zurich, Norwich Union and Fortis, the academy is aimed at providing forums for brokers to raise industry issues.

It is also understood that Biba and the IIB will publicly commit to supporting the initiative. It is the first time that the CII has come together with Biba and the IIB to push forward a programme aimed at raising the professionalism of the industry.

FSA warns on savings ads
The FSA warned insurers and broker to stop using premium savings claims which could mislead consumers in their advertising. The FSA found that more than half of motor insurance advertisements with savings claims were either unclear or misleading. It also had the same concerns with a quarter of the home insurance advertisements. Travel insurance saving claims were generally of a higher standard.

Zurich's broker offer
Zurich has launched its new Broker Alliance programme. As reported in Insurance Times (News, 7 December), the insurer is offering broker members a single account executive for both personal and commercial lines.

FSA deadline 'optimistic'
Consultant Moore Stephens questioned the London market's ability to meet the FSA's contract certainty deadline. It said the target of achieving between 75% and 80% compliance looked "optimistic".
